Имя: Пароль:
1C
1С v8
8.3 Невозможно применить фиксированные настройки. Пересекаются элементы отбора.
0 RomaH
 
naïve
07.06.13
11:06
Параметры Отбора, Сортировки, Группировки или список отображаемых полей заданы неверно.
по причине:
Невозможно применить фиксированные настройки. Пересекаются элементы отбора.

вот такая вот первая ошибка
на форме дин спсиок с простым запросом к журналу (произвольный запрос - журнал вкачестве основной таблицы)

отборов никаких нет изначально

делаю:

&НаСервере
Процедура ПриСозданииНаСервере(Отказ, СтандартнаяОбработка)
   СписокПациентов = ПолучитьСпиоскПациентовПоОтбору(); //На самом деле массив
   ОбщегоНазначенияКлиентСервер.УстановитьЭлементОтбора(Список.Отбор,"Пациент",СписокПациентов);
КонецПроцедуры

и получаю вышеуказаннное с предложением закрыть или перезапустить

о чем это вообще и как лечить?
1 RomaH
 
naïve
07.06.13
11:16
так, просто списки перепутал
оказывается в Списке уже указан отбор по пациенту
(на 8.2. работало все - а тут на тебе)
отбор по умоляанию убрал - теперь другая ошибка вылезла
и это на простейшем
мда, буду разбираться
2 RomaH
 
naïve
07.06.13
11:29
во как

теперь появилось
   Список.КомпоновщикНастроек.Настройки.Отбор

КомпоновщикНастроек.Настройки.

но не понимаю как его заставить работать
переписал все отборы через "КомпоновщикНастроек.Настройки."

вроде все правильно - Пациент В Списке (массив с 10 пациентами)
но показывает пустой спсок (друих отбором нет)
что не так?
Есть два вида языков, одни постоянно ругают, а вторыми никто не пользуется.